Campfire Avocado Mash

Ingredients

  • 2 glutino english muffins
  • 100 g of old cheddar cheese
  • 1 avocado
  • 2 tablespoons of salsa
  • bacon or smoked chicken breast, like I used
  • castiron pan
  • campfire

Instructions

  • First - gather your ingredients.
  • Up next, get the cast iron pan on the fire and toast the english muffins middle side down.
  • While the english muffins are toasting get your avocado ready and cut the cheese into small slices.
  • Now, sandwich the cheese between the english muffin - this is the best way to melt it. Flip every so often as to not burn the outside of the english muffin. Cook the smoked chicken in the pan.
  • Once the cheese is melted and the chicken cooked, open up the english muffin and mash the avocado onto one side. Top with salsa and top the other side with the smoked chicken.
  • Close back up and you're done!
